Before starting his work at A1 Alliance Counseling, he worked in private practice, and in residential treatment for adolescents, as well as sexual addiction and recovery. He has worked with individuals, couples, families, and groups through life’s most difficult circumstances.

Education: 

Colby graduated with his Bachelor’s degree from Weber State University in Family Studies. His desire to embrace diversity led him to choose the University of Southern Mississippi to complete his Master’s degree in Marriage and Family Therapy. He is dedicated to obtaining an education that best meets the diverse needs of those he works with in a therapeutic setting. He has participated and presented in numerous conferences on the local, state, national, and international levels.
